Army rescues another abducted Chibok girl
January 5, 2018
In a statement released by the Deputy Director of Public Relations, Theatre Command Operation Lafiya Dole, Colonel Onyema Nwachukwu, it’s made known that one of the abducted Chibok girls have been rescued.
Nwachukwu said the girl was rescued on Thursday, January 4, by the troops of Operation Lafiya Dole deployed in Pulka.
The statement reads, “So far, preliminary investigations reveal that the young girl identified as Salomi Pagu is the same as the Chibok girl published on the list of abducted Chibok girls with serial 86.
“Currently, the girl who was intercepted in the company of another young girl, Jamila Adams, about 14 years old with a child, are in the safe custody of troops and receiving medical attention”.
